Questions & Answers

What companies run services between London, England and Great Howarth, England?

Avanti West Coast operates a train from London Euston to Manchester Piccadilly every 30 minutes. Tickets cost £65–110 and the journey takes 2h 12m. Alternatively, National Express operates a bus from London Victoria to Rochdale Interchange 3 times a week. Tickets cost £40–100 and the journey takes 5h 50m.
